In magnetic coils, there is often the task of to change the amount of inductance or the magnetic force. Both are achieved through a change in magnetic reluctance. This is maintained by inserting it of sheet metal in the usually existing air gap in the desired way. However, this method is often associated with difficulties, especially with relays, as it requires the connections of the iron circle. to solve again.

Damit die Bewegung des Joches 3 durch die Anschlüsse 7 der Spule nicht gestört wird, ist diese drehbar innerhalb des durch die äußeren Bleche 5 gebildeten Hohlkörpers angeordnet.In the figure is a coil as an embodiment of the invention i, which is wound over a core 2. With the core are two yokes 3 and 4 firmly connected. The core with the yokes is rotatably arranged. Around the coil iron sheets 5 are placed, which at the different points of the circumference of the coil have a different magnetic resistance. In the embodiment this is achieved by the fact that at individual points of the circumference a different Number of sheets of the same thickness is stacked on top of one another. Air gaps6 can also be arranged at individual points. Depending on the position of the yokes 3 is formed then a different total resistance for the iron route. So that the movement of the yoke 3 is not disturbed by the connections 7 of the coil, the coil can be rotated arranged within the hollow body formed by the outer metal sheets 5.
